Financials Achilles Corporation

Equities

5142

JP3108000005

Commodity Chemicals

Market Closed - Japan Exchange 02:00:00 2024-04-26 am EDT 5-day change 1st Jan Change
1,574 JPY +1.48% Intraday chart for Achilles Corporation +4.86% +2.01%

Valuation

Fiscal Period: March 2018 2019 2020 2021 2022 2023
Capitalization 1 37,251 31,025 27,567 23,312 19,885 19,926
Enterprise Value (EV) 1 33,828 31,044 25,776 20,380 17,495 24,139
P/E ratio 16.5 x 93.2 x 14.6 x 7.25 x 13 x -17.3 x
Yield 1.83% 2.1% 2.28% 2.7% 3.16% 2.95%
Capitalization / Revenue 0.42 x 0.36 x 0.34 x 0.32 x 0.26 x 0.24 x
EV / Revenue 0.38 x 0.36 x 0.32 x 0.28 x 0.23 x 0.29 x
EV / EBITDA 6.57 x 7 x 5.32 x 4.36 x 4.36 x 9.22 x
EV / FCF 114 x -24.3 x 14.9 x -23.9 x -9.48 x -4.21 x
FCF Yield 0.88% -4.12% 6.72% -4.18% -10.5% -23.8%
Price to Book 0.82 x 0.73 x 0.67 x 0.5 x 0.42 x 0.44 x
Nbr of stocks (in thousands) 17,064 16,252 15,726 15,709 15,707 14,705
Reference price 2 2,183 1,909 1,753 1,484 1,266 1,355
Announcement Date 6/28/18 6/27/19 6/26/20 6/29/21 6/29/22 6/29/23
1JPY in Million2JPY
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: March 2018 2019 2020 2021 2022 2023
Net sales 1 87,910 85,705 80,225 73,617 75,953 82,917
EBITDA 1 5,149 4,434 4,842 4,678 4,016 2,617
EBIT 1 2,344 1,403 1,603 1,571 856 -712
Operating Margin 2.67% 1.64% 2% 2.13% 1.13% -0.86%
Earnings before Tax (EBT) 1 2,918 804 2,590 4,147 2,229 -1,242
Net income 1 2,284 338 1,895 3,215 1,525 -1,204
Net margin 2.6% 0.39% 2.36% 4.37% 2.01% -1.45%
EPS 2 132.4 20.49 120.3 204.7 97.11 -78.16
Free Cash Flow 1 296.8 -1,278 1,732 -851.4 -1,845 -5,733
FCF margin 0.34% -1.49% 2.16% -1.16% -2.43% -6.91%
FCF Conversion (EBITDA) 5.76% - 35.76% - - -
FCF Conversion (Net income) 12.99% - 91.37% - - -
Dividend per Share 2 40.00 40.00 40.00 40.00 40.00 40.00
Announcement Date 6/28/18 6/27/19 6/26/20 6/29/21 6/29/22 6/29/23
1JPY in Million2JPY
Estimates

Income Statement Evolution (Quarterly data)

Fiscal Period: March 2020 S1 2021 S1 2022 S1 2022 Q3 2023 Q1 2023 S1 2023 Q3 2024 Q1 2024 S1 2024 Q3
Net sales 1 39,936 34,102 36,431 19,407 19,132 40,800 22,250 18,596 38,182 21,095
EBITDA - - - - - - - - - -
EBIT 1 676 357 608 411 -57 -102 53 -435 -519 83
Operating Margin 1.69% 1.05% 1.67% 2.12% -0.3% -0.25% 0.24% -2.34% -1.36% 0.39%
Earnings before Tax (EBT) 1 842 2,754 838 640 333 447 -16 -210 384 -4,913
Net income 1 624 2,212 515 367 133 166 -88 -182 154 -7,791
Net margin 1.56% 6.49% 1.41% 1.89% 0.7% 0.41% -0.4% -0.98% 0.4% -36.93%
EPS 2 39.60 140.8 32.83 23.38 8.550 10.73 -5.670 -12.19 10.41 -528.5
Dividend per Share - - - - - - - - - -
Announcement Date 11/8/19 11/10/20 11/10/21 2/8/22 8/9/22 11/11/22 2/10/23 8/9/23 11/9/23 2/9/24
1JPY in Million2JPY
Estimates

Balance Sheet Analysis

Fiscal Period: March 2018 2019 2020 2021 2022 2023
Net Debt 1 - 19 - - - 4,213
Net Cash position 1 3,423 - 1,791 2,932 2,390 -
Leverage (Debt/EBITDA) - 0.004285 x - - - 1.61 x
Free Cash Flow 1 297 -1,278 1,732 -851 -1,845 -5,733
ROE (net income / shareholders' equity) 5.08% 0.78% 4.56% 7.33% 3.24% -2.56%
ROA (Net income/ Total Assets) 1.84% 1.14% 1.36% 1.32% 0.68% -0.54%
Assets 1 124,178 29,772 139,164 244,134 223,771 225,047
Book Value Per Share 2 2,672 2,621 2,632 2,953 3,050 3,059
Cash Flow per Share 2 513.0 327.0 446.0 518.0 485.0 456.0
Capex 1 4,262 4,544 4,689 5,242 6,113 4,838
Capex / Sales 4.85% 5.3% 5.84% 7.12% 8.05% 5.83%
Announcement Date 6/28/18 6/27/19 6/26/20 6/29/21 6/29/22 6/29/23
1JPY in Million2JPY
Estimates
  1. Stock Market
  2. Equities
  3. 5142 Stock
  4. Financials Achilles Corporation